Only 1/3 of all high school physics teachers have a degree in physics or physics education. Almost 1/3 of all high school physics teachers have taken fewer than 3 college physics classes. 90% of middle school students are taught physical science by a teacher lacking a major or certification in the physical sciences (chemistry, geology, general science or physics). Our local and regional school districts have had substantial difficulty finding and retaining qualified physics teachers. 52% of New York City high schools do not even offer physics. Of all school subjects, Physics has the most severe teacher shortage, followed by math and chemistry. There are large surpluses of biology and earth science teachers. http://phystec.physics.cornell.edu/content/crisis-physics-education -- The Starmaker -- To question the unquestionable, ask the unaskable, to think the unthinkable, mention the unmentionable, say the unsayable, and challenge the unchallengeable.
